Devontae Shuler Gets NBA Shot, Signs with Mavs for Summer League

Devontae Shuler Gets NBA Shot, Signs with Mavs for Summer League

At the conclusion of the 2021 NBA Draft on Thursday, Devontae Shuler did not hear his name called. Similar to Breein Tyree who was an UDFA last season, Shuler will look to take a different path to try and reach the NBA. The good news is that he will get an opportunity to prove his ability for the Dallas Mavericks in the NBA’s Summer League series.

There will be three different leagues taking place during the month of August. The Mavericks will participate in the Las Vegas League which will take place from August 8th-17th. Dallas has already leaked its schedule with four nationally televised games starting on August 9th. The matchup against the Sacramento Kings will be featured on ESPN2 on August 15th at 2PM.

This past season, Shuler earned First Team All-SEC honors while leading the Rebels in scoring (15.3 PPG) and assists (3.3) per game. Over his entire Ole Miss career, Shuler started 97 contests for the Rebels. He ranks third in program history in steals while also cracking the Top-10 in three pointers made (8th) and assists (10th). He joins Tyree as the only Rebels under head coach Kermit Davis to earn first team honors.

Dallas Mavericks have already confirmed the names of other members of their roster. Shuler will be joined in Las Vegas by:  EJ Onu, Feron Hunt, Carlik Jones, Eugene Omoruyi, and LJ Figureoa. The Mavericks did not own any picks in the 2021 NBA Draft.
